Midnight Flood: 21 Bodies Discovered, 50 Homes Destroyed
Tragedy struck Mokwa Local Government Area of Niger State on Tuesday night as torrential rainfall triggered a devastating midnight flood, claiming at least 21 lives and leaving dozens of people missing. Gov Bago Approves six months maternity leave for women
Niger State Governor Extends Maternity Leave to Six Months, Announces Major Development Initiatives In a landmark policy move aimed at improving maternal and child health, the Governor of Niger State, Mohammed Umaru Bago, has approved the extension of maternity leave for women in the state’s civil service from three months to six months. EFCC Arrests 40 Suspected Internet Fraudsters
The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C) has apprehended 40 suspected internet fraudsters in Niger State, following a series of raids conducted by its Kaduna Zonal Directorate.
